The Return of Warm Wood Tones


For many years, white and grey kitchens dominated style trends, offering a clean and innovative visual. While these schemes still have their location, home owners are inclining rich, warm wood tones that bring depth and personality back right into the kitchen. Cabinetry in walnut, cherry, and oak is restoring appeal, including a natural and classic feel to the area. These natural environments develop a feeling of heat that contrasts beautifully with modern-day home appliances and components, making the cooking area really feel welcoming and lived-in.


Timeless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ship


Shaker-style closets, beadboard information, and intricate moldings are resurfacing as chosen selections in kitchen area restorations. Homeowners value the workmanship and personality that typical cabinet designs supply. The simpleness of shaker cabinets makes them versatile, combining well with both modern-day and vintage-inspired design. Glass-front cupboards are likewise seeing a resurgence, providing an elegant means to showcase valued dishware and glassware while including an open, ventilated feeling to the kitchen.


Vintage-Inspired Backsplashes That Steal the Show


Backsplashes have actually always played a considerable duty in kitchen design, and currently, they're ending up being a focal point once more. Classic metro floor tiles, especially in a little uneven or handcrafted versions, bring a touch of old-world charm while keeping a timeless allure. Patterned ceramic tiles, similar to European kitchen areas, are one more preferred selection. These layouts add individuality and a sense of virtuosity, transforming a common kitchen area wall surface into a striking feature.


Restoring the Butcher Block Countertop


While rock countertops like quartz and granite have actually been preferred for their sturdiness, many homeowners are finding the appeal and performance of butcher block countertops. The warmth of wood counter tops not just boosts a classic kitchen visual however additionally offers a sensible surface for meal preparation. Whether used as a full kitchen counter or as an accent on a kitchen island, butcher block surfaces bring a sense of rustic charm and functionality to any space.


Statement Lighting with a Nostalgic Twist


Lights is essential in creating ambiance, and vintage-inspired components are taking spotlight in classic kitchen designs. Pendant lights with aged brass, functioned iron, or glass tones evocative early 20th-century styles are making a comeback. Extra-large components and industrial-style illumination add character and enhance the traditional look. Whether you prefer a cozy, dark glow or brilliant job illumination, the ideal fixtures can boost the total visual while enhancing functionality.


The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ets


Couple of aspects stimulate classic kitchen design rather like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not just aesthetically attractive however also highly practical, accommodating huge pots and pans effortlessly. Paired with bridge faucets, which feature a timeless, exposed-plumbing look, these sinks add to the old-world charm that a lot of homeowners are yearning. The combination of these fixtures blends history with modern convenience, making them a must-have for anyone seeking to revitalize a classic kitchen aesthetic.


Vintage-Inspired Appliances: Modern Functionality Meets Nostalgic Appeal


While stainless-steel devices remain a staple in modern-day cooking areas, many homeowners are attracted to vintage-inspired designs that mix effortlessly with timeless design. Retro-style fridges, stoves with timeless handles and dials, and range hoods with elaborate describing include an one-of-a-kind charm to the room. These home appliances offer contemporary performance while keeping the aesthetic appeal of lost periods, permitting house owners to delight in the most effective of both worlds.


Comfortable and Inviting Kitchen Dining Areas


The idea of an eat-in cooking area is returning as home owners welcome the warmth of common dishes and informal gatherings. Dining room with integrated seating, farmhouse tables, and upholstered chairs develop a comfortable and welcoming environment. Whether it's a traditional wooden table or a vintage-inspired banquette, these rooms encourage link and convenience, strengthening the idea of the kitchen area as the heart of the home.


Ornamental Accents That Tell a Story


The charm of classic kitchens hinges on the details. Ornamental components such as open shelving with very carefully curated dishware, antique-inspired equipment, and handmade textiles contribute to a nostalgic, individualized touch. Blending modern-day eases with ageless decoration allows for a balance of function and aesthetic, making certain that the space remains both practical and visually enticing.
